
"After four days of jury selection, opening statements began in Las Vegas court Tuesday in the trial of Nathan Chasing Horse, an actor and self-proclaimed spiritual leader accused of abusing Indigenous girls and women for over two decades. Chasing Horse, who's best known for playing a character named Smiles a Lot in the 1990 Oscar-winning western Dancing with Wolves, was arrested in North Las Vegas in January 2023 following months of investigation into alleged sex crimes he'd committed in Clark County."
"The actor is accused of sexually assaulting one of his victims, a 14-year-old girl, after telling her that she needed to give up her virginity to help her mother, who was diagnosed with cancer. [The victim] wanted to appease the spirits, Clark County Deputy District Attorney Bianca Pucci told the court. She wanted to appease the medicine man, who was 36 at the time of the alleged crime."

He faces 21 charges, including sexual assault, sexual assault of a minor, kidnapping of a minor and use of a minor in producing pornography. Prosecutors allege Chasing Horse used his role as a spiritual healer and medicine man to prey on victims who trusted him. One alleged victim, then 14, was told to give up her virginity to help her sick mother and was sexually assaulted on a 2012 road trip. Another alleged victim who participated in Lakota ceremonies was tattooed to remind herself to remain silent. Chasing Horse has denied the accusations.
